There are people who are pleasant and … Web15 nov. 2024 · The Resiliency of a Filipino is Built into the Culture A little-known fact about Filipinos is that a polite way of greeting someone is to invite them to share your food. When you approach Filipinos while they’re enjoying a meal, they will greet you with a cheery “Kain tayo or Kaon ta,” which translates to “Let’s eat.” little boy tablet

Web18 feb. 2012 · Some of the most common words for showing respect in a Filipino household are po and opo. Both basically mean "yes" respectfully, rather than just saying oo, or yes normally. To better understand how to use po and opo and learn the difference between the two, look at the examples below. WebFilipino hospitality has no borders or boundaries.
